Conveyor and Process Belts (PVC, PU, PE, Polyester, Silicone Covers): A Comprehensive Guide:

Conveyors and process belts play a pivotal role in numerous industries, facilitating the smooth transportation of goods and materials within manufacturing and production processes. These belts, available in various materials such as PVC, PU, PE, Polyester, and Silicone Covers, offer distinct advantages and features that make them suitable for different applications. In this comprehensive guide, we will delve into the world of conveyor and process belts, exploring their characteristics, applications, and benefits.

PVC Belts - Versatile and Resilient

P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) belts are widely used in industries that require resistance to oil, chemicals, and abrasion. They offer excellent dimensional stability and are suitable for applications such as food processing, packaging, logistics, and general conveying.

Benefits of PVC Belts

 

· High tensile strength ensures durability and longevity.

· Excellent resistance to chemicals, oils, and abrasion.

· Wide range of colors and surface finishes available.

· Easy to clean and maintain.

· Cost-effective option for various industries.

 

PU Belts - Optimal Efficiency and Performance

PU (Polyurethane) belts are known for their exceptional flexibility, resistance to wear and tear, and compatibility with a wide range of applications. They are commonly used in the automotive, textile, Food, and printing industries.

Advantages of PU Belts

 

· High flexibility and elasticity for smooth conveying and reduced vibrations.

· Excellent resistance to oils, greases, and chemicals.

· Superior abrasion resistance for extended belt life.

· A high coefficient of friction ensures efficient power transmission.

· Wide temperature range for versatility in different environments.

 

PE Belts - Lightweight and Durable

PE (Polyethylene) belts offer a combination of strength, flexibility, and lightweight properties. They are widely used in the food industry, agriculture, and pharmaceuticals.

Key Features of PE Belts

 

· Low coefficient of friction for smooth and efficient conveying.

· Excellent resistance to water, moisture, and chemicals.

· Hygienic and easy to clean, making them suitable for food-related applications.

· The lightweight design minimizes energy consumption and reduces strain on equipment.

· Exceptional durability for long-lasting performance.

 

Polyester Belts - Strength and Stability

Polyester belts are known for their high tensile strength and dimensional stability, making them ideal for heavy-duty applications in industries such as mining, construction, and steel manufacturing.

Advantages of Polyester Belts

 

· Excellent resistance to tearing, stretching, and impact.

· Low elongation under high tension, ensuring stable conveying.

· Superior heat resistance for demanding environments.

· Reduced maintenance and downtime due to high durability.

· Suitable for conveying heavy loads and bulk materials.

Silicone Covers - Heat Resistance and Release Properties

Silicone covers provide exceptional heat resistance and release properties, making them ideal for applications that involve high temperatures and sticky materials. Industries like baking, confectionery, and textile benefit greatly from these belts.

Features of Silicone Covers

 

· Outstanding resistance to high temperatures, up to 230°C (446°F).

· Non-stick surface prevents materials from adhering.

· Suitable for use in food-grade applications.

· Excellent release properties, minimizing product loss and downtime.

· Enhanced flexibility for easy installation and tracking.
